3-(4-Methoxyphenyl)propionic acid
3-(4-Methoxyphenyl)propionic acid (CAS: 1929-29-9; Formula: C10H12O3; Molar Mass: 180.20 g/mol) is a carboxylic acid derivative featuring a methoxy-substituted phenyl ring. It serves as a valuable organic building block in chemical synthesis. This compound is commonly employed in the development of novel molecules and is a useful intermediate in research and development settings within the fine chemical and pharmaceutical industries.

| Molecular weight | 180.20 |
|---|---|
| Linear formula | CH3OC6H4CH2CH2CO2H |
| Assay | 98% |
| Melting point | 98-100 °C(lit.) |
| Protective equipment | Eyeshields, Gloves, type N95 (US), type P1 (EN143) respirator filter |
|---|---|
| Water hazard class (WGK, DE) | 3 |
